Detailed information for compound 1821301

Basic information

Technical information
  • Name: Unnamed compound
  • MW: 342.432 | Formula: C20H26N2O3
  • H donors: 2 H acceptors: 2 LogP: 3.7 Rotable bonds: 8
    Rule of 5 violations (Lipinski): 1
  • SMILES: O=C(C(=O)NOCc1ccccc1)NCC12CC3CC(C2)CC(C1)C3
  • InChi: 1S/C20H26N2O3/c23-18(19(24)22-25-12-14-4-2-1-3-5-14)21-13-20-9-15-6-16(10-20)8-17(7-15)11-20/h1-5,15-17H,6-13H2,(H,21,23)(H,22,24)
  • InChiKey: QHSMGIMXVFFMNL-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
IC50 (binding) = 838 nM Inhibition of recombinant human sEH expressed in Sf9 cells using CMNPC as substrate assessed as release of 6-methoxy-2-naphthaldehyde preincubated for 10 mins before substrate addition measured after 10 mins by fluorometer analysis ChEMBL. 24433964
